The village of Střítež nad Ludinou lies north of the town of Hranice and in a long valley formed by the river Ludina and the southern peaks of the Oder Hills. Strítež is a relatively large village with 836 inhabitants. Strítež is an elongated village reaching a length of 3 kilometers. The name of the village originated from the suffix -ež to the name stret, which is etymologically related to reed? means reedy place. The first mention of the village dates back to 1371.…
